Hitomaru
人丸Fuyuki
冬樹"Creating the best sake with our local 'Akita Komachi' table rice, not just sake rice." Born from this passionate challenge, Fuyuki is the innovative brand of Fukunotomo Shuzo. Its defining feature is the insistence on "Muroka Genshu" (unfiltered and undiluted), maximizing the potential of table rice. The dynamic umami filled with life force straight from the press is bottled as is, possessing a dignified strength like trees in winter. Beyond the framework of conventional sake, it offers a dense sweetness and fresh acidity unique to the rice. This pure drop, directly conveying the brewer's will, is an opening to a new world of sake, attracting intense attention from savvy enthusiasts.
Yukinohana
雪の花Yuki no Hana was the flagship brand of Yuki no Hana Shuzo. Brewed in the 'Shuzo Ginza' of Otaru's Ironai district, it was a local sake that symbolized the era of growth alongside the Otaru Canal. Named after the landscape of snowy Hokkaido and the port culture of Otaru, this brand was long cherished by locals. Once, many breweries in Otaru supported Hokkaido's sake culture, but many closed during the Heisei period due to shifting tastes and a lack of Toji. Yuki no Hana is remembered as a historical brand that preserves Otaru's sake-brewing heritage. It is a precious record of a local sake from Otaru's peak of prosperity.
Oyadama Kita no Homare
親玉 北の誉Oyadama Kitanohomare is a top-selling Nigori (cloudy) sake from the Asahikawa Distillery. Brewed with 100% Hokkaido rice, it features a rich, bold body with a pleasant acidity that pairs exceptionally well with meat dishes.

Yamakawa Mitsuo
山川光男"Challenge, play, and evolve." Yamakawa Mitsuo, presented by four elite Yamagata breweries, is a unit brand blowing a fresh breeze through the sake world. The unique character on the label, resembling a quirky older man, expresses the desire for people to enjoy sake more freely and casually. Every year, the four breweries pool their wisdom to create flavors with changing themes of rice and yeast, perfectly balancing fresh discovery with reliable quality. Released seasonally (Spring, Summer, Autumn, Winter), each bottle is filled with the depth of Yamagata's technology and the playful spirit of the brewers. It is an "entertainment sake" that keeps drinkers excited to see what comes next.

Uyo Otoyama
羽陽男山Uyo Otoyama, the flagship brand of Otoyama Shuzo, is nationally acclaimed for its sophisticated and sharp dry profile crafted with Zao's spring water. With 16 gold medals at the National New Sake Awards, its exceptional quality is a result of over 200 years of tradition combined with Yamagata's harsh winters. The name "Uyo" proudly marks its origin as Yamagata's Otokoyama, serving as a premium brew that perfectly enhances any culinary experience.
Nanuka
ナヌカNanuka is a revolutionary blend created from the premium brews of three distinct Yamagata breweries: Otoyama, Kajo Kotobuki, and Shuho. Planned by the specialist store "La Jomon" and crafted with traditional expertise, it achieves a deep, multilayered complexity impossible for a single brewery alone. Named "Nanuka" (7th) as a clever nod to its location in Yokamachi (8th Town), this "entertainment sake" celebrates local bonds and a playful spirit.
